Teddy E. “Ted” Patterson, 75, Newton died on Tuesday, Sept. 25, 2012, at the VA Medical Center in Des Moines.

As per Ted’s wishes he has been cremated and there will be no services at this time.

Burial of cremated remains will be at a later date at the Newton Union Cemetery in Newton.

Memorials in Ted’s name may be left at the funeral home. Memorials also may be mailed to the funeral home. Please add, Attn: Patterson Family on the envelope.

Survivors include his wife, Sue of Newton; children, Michael (Helene) Patterson Schuylerville, New York, Darci (Mike) Fairchild of Des Moines and Brian (Jean) Patterson of Cedar Creek, New Mexico; nine grandchildren and his brothers and sister, Harold (Ann) Patterson of Monroe, Georgia, Jim (Cuba) Patterson of Newton and Margaret (Jim) Cobbs of Newton.

He was preceded in death by his parents, Walter H. and Marjorie L. (Martin) Patterson; and  son, Larry in 1995.
